🔍 What Exactly Is Rib Flare and Why Should You Care?
Rib flare occurs when your lower ribs protrude forward and upward, breaking the natural alignment between your ribcage and pelvis. Imagine your torso as a cylinder—when properly aligned, the top rim (ribs) and bottom rim (pelvis) should be stacked vertically. With rib flare, the top rim tilts backward while the bottom often tilts forward, creating a dysfunctional core cylinder.
This misalignment isn’t just a cosmetic concern. When your ribs flare, your diaphragm shifts into a poor position, preventing it from functioning optimally as both a breathing muscle and a core stabilizer. Your abdominal muscles become stretched and mechanically disadvantaged, unable to generate the intra-abdominal pressure necessary for safe, effective lifting.
Athletes and fitness enthusiasts with chronic rib flare often experience lower back pain, shoulder issues, and plateaus in their lifting numbers. They’re essentially trying to build a house on a faulty foundation—no amount of heavy deadlifts or intensive ab work will fix the underlying structural problem.
💪 The Core Connection: How Rib Position Affects Strength
Your core isn’t just your abs—it’s a coordinated system involving your diaphragm, pelvic floor, transverse abdominis, multifidus, and obliques working together to create 360-degree stability. When your ribs are properly positioned, this system functions like a pressurized canister, distributing forces evenly and protecting your spine during heavy loads.
Rib flare disrupts this coordination by placing your diaphragm in an overly flat, horizontal position. Instead of descending properly during inhalation to create pressure, it remains relatively static. Your body compensates by overusing accessory breathing muscles in your neck and shoulders, which should only activate during intense exertion.
This compensation pattern creates a cascade of problems. Your neck and traps become chronically tight. Your lower back arches excessively to maintain balance. Your glutes shut off because your pelvis is tilted forward. Suddenly, that squat that should engage your entire posterior chain becomes a quad-dominant movement with questionable spinal loading.
The Breathing-Bracing Connection
Proper breathing mechanics are inseparable from core stability. When you breathe correctly with good rib position, your diaphragm descends, your ribcage expands laterally and posteriorly (not upward), and your core naturally engages to manage the pressure change.
With rib flare, you’re stuck in a pattern of chest breathing—breathing that lifts your ribs up rather than expanding them outward. This shallow breathing pattern never properly engages your deep core stabilizers, leaving you vulnerable under load.
🎯 Top Visual and Tactile Cues to Identify Rib Flare
Before you can fix rib flare, you need to recognize it in yourself and during exercises. Here are the most reliable assessment methods:
- The Wall Test: Stand with your back against a wall, heels about six inches away. Your head, upper back, and butt should touch the wall. If there’s more than a hand’s width of space between your lower back and the wall, or if your ribs protrude noticeably forward, you likely have rib flare.
- The Lying Test: Lie on your back with knees bent. Place your hands on your lower ribs. Can you feel them pointing more toward the ceiling than your hips? That’s rib flare. Your ribs should angle slightly downward toward your pelvis.
- The Breathing Test: Place one hand on your chest and one on your belly. Breathe normally. If your chest hand rises significantly more than your belly hand, you’re chest breathing—a common companion to rib flare.
- The Mirror Test: Stand sideways in front of a mirror in just shorts or fitted clothing. Draw an imaginary line from your armpit straight down. Does it pass through your hip, or do your ribs protrude forward of this line?
🛠️ Foundational Cues for Correcting Rib Position
Now that you can identify rib flare, let’s explore the most effective coaching cues to correct it. These cues work by creating new neurological patterns that override your habitual positioning.
The “Ribs Down” Cue
This is the most direct cue, but it needs proper context. “Ribs down” doesn’t mean collapsing your chest or slouching forward. Instead, think of gently drawing your lower front ribs down and in toward your pelvis, creating a slight posterior tilt of your ribcage while maintaining length through your spine.
Practice this standing against a wall. Place your hands on your lower ribs and gently guide them downward as you exhale. You should feel your abs engage slightly and the space between your lower back and wall decrease without tucking your pelvis under excessively.
The “Zipper Up” Visualization
Imagine a zipper running from your pubic bone to your sternum. As you exhale, visualize zipping this imaginary zipper upward, bringing your ribs and pelvis closer together. This cue naturally engages your transverse abdominis and internal obliques while repositioning your ribcage.
This works exceptionally well during exercises like planks, push-ups, and overhead presses where maintaining core tension is crucial.
The “Long Exhale” Strategy
Your diaphragm is a breathing muscle first, core stabilizer second. Full exhalations naturally draw your ribs downward and inward. Practice breathing where your exhale is twice as long as your inhale (for example, inhale for three counts, exhale for six).
During this extended exhale, feel how your ribs naturally descend and your core gently engages. This is the position you want to maintain during exercises.
The “Lat Engagement” Technique
Your latissimus dorsi muscles attach to your ribcage and can actually help pull your ribs down into proper position. Before lifting, think about gently pulling your lats down and back—like you’re trying to tuck them into your back pockets. This subtle engagement creates better rib positioning and shoulder stability simultaneously.
📋 Exercise-Specific Cueing for Common Movements
Different exercises require slightly different approaches to maintaining good rib position. Here’s how to apply these principles to common strength training movements:
Overhead Pressing Movements
Overhead presses are rib flare’s favorite playground. As you press weight overhead, your body wants to compensate for limited shoulder mobility by extending through your lower back and flaring your ribs forward.
Key cues: Before you press, take a breath into your belly and “lock” your ribs down by engaging your abs. As you press overhead, exhale steadily while maintaining this rib position. Think about reaching the weight toward the ceiling while keeping your ribs over your pelvis, not behind it.
If you can’t press overhead without rib flare, your weight is too heavy or your shoulder mobility needs work. Drop the weight and perfect the pattern first.
Planks and Push-Ups
These horizontal pressing patterns often reveal rib flare dramatically. In a poor plank, you’ll see a sway-back position with ribs drooping toward the floor and lower back arched.
Key cues: Set up your plank, then think about “hollowing” slightly—drawing your lower ribs up toward your spine while maintaining a neutral neck and head position. Your body should form a straight line from head to heels, but internally, you’re creating gentle tension by zipping up that imaginary zipper we discussed earlier.
For push-ups, maintain this tension throughout the movement. Exhale as you push up, using the breath to reinforce rib position.
Squats and Deadlifts
These fundamental movements require tremendous core stability. Rib flare during these lifts often accompanies lower back hyperextension, creating dangerous spinal loading patterns.
Key cues: After you’ve braced and before you descend into your squat, check your rib position. You should feel stacked and solid, not arched back. During the lift, imagine you’re trying to shorten the distance between your ribs and hips—this prevents extension and maintains neutral spine.
For deadlifts, the same principle applies at lockout. Many lifters complete the movement by leaning back and flaring their ribs. Instead, finish by driving your hips forward while keeping your ribs stacked over your pelvis.
Loaded Carries
Farmer’s carries, overhead carries, and suitcase carries are exceptional for training anti-rib flare stability because they create real-world asymmetrical or overhead loading demands.
Key cues: Before you start walking, establish perfect posture—ribs down, shoulders back, core engaged. As you walk, the weight will try to pull you out of position. Resist by maintaining that zipper-up feeling and breathing behind your stabilized core (don’t hold your breath, but breathe without losing position).
🏋️ Building a Rib Flare Correction Warm-Up Routine
Correcting rib flare isn’t just about cueing during exercises—it requires dedicated mobility and activation work. Here’s a comprehensive warm-up sequence you can use before strength training:
- 90/90 Hip Flexor Breathing (2 minutes): Lie on your back with hips and knees at 90 degrees, feet on a wall or elevated surface. Focus on feeling your entire back contact the floor as you take deep belly breaths. This resets your diaphragm position.
- Dead Bugs (3 sets of 8 reps): From the same position, slowly extend opposite arm and leg while maintaining back contact with the floor. This challenges your ability to maintain rib position against resistance.
- Quadruped Breathing (2 minutes): On hands and knees, round your upper back slightly and breathe into your back and sides. This activates your deep core stabilizers and teaches proper breathing mechanics.
- Wall Slides (2 sets of 10 reps): Standing against a wall, slide your arms overhead while keeping your ribs down and lower back relatively flat against the wall. This improves overhead mobility while maintaining good core position.
- Pallof Press Hold (3 sets of 20-30 seconds each side): This anti-rotation exercise forces you to maintain rib position against a pulling force, building the exact stability you need for heavy lifting.
⚡ Common Mistakes and Troubleshooting
Even with good cues, lifters often make predictable mistakes when trying to fix rib flare. Here’s how to avoid them:
Overcorrecting Into Excessive Flexion
Some people interpret “ribs down” as “round forward like a scared cat.” This trades one problem for another. Your spine should remain relatively neutral—you’re adjusting rib position, not creating thoracic flexion.
Solution: Think about maintaining proud chest posture while gently drawing your lower ribs toward your pelvis. The movement is subtle, not dramatic.
Holding Your Breath
In an attempt to maintain core stability, many lifters hold their breath excessively, especially during challenging sets. While breath-holding (Valsalva maneuver) has its place in maximal lifting, chronic breath-holding with poor rib position reinforces bad patterns.
Solution: Learn to breathe behind a stable core. Your ribs shouldn’t lift dramatically with each breath during exercise. Practice maintaining rib position while breathing during moderate-intensity work.
Only Focusing on the Front Body
Rib flare correction isn’t just about your abs—it’s about creating balanced 360-degree tension. Your back muscles, particularly your lats and serratus anterior, play crucial roles in maintaining proper rib position.
Solution: Include back-strengthening work, particularly exercises that emphasize lat engagement like rows, pull-downs, and carries. Think about your core as a complete cylinder, not just a six-pack.
🎓 Advanced Considerations for Athletic Performance
For athletes and advanced lifters, rib positioning becomes even more nuanced. Different sports and activities may require slight variations in how you manage your core and ribcage.
Powerlifters, for instance, often use deliberate arch in bench press, which includes some ribcage extension. The key difference is that this is controlled, purposeful positioning for a specific lift, not a habitual postural dysfunction that persists throughout training.
Olympic weightlifters need exceptional overhead mobility combined with core stability. Their rib position during a snatch overhead squat might look slightly different than a strict press, but the underlying principle remains—maintaining a stable, pressurized core cylinder that doesn’t compensate through excessive spinal extension.
Endurance athletes often develop rib flare from breathing pattern dysfunction during long efforts. Incorporating specific respiratory training alongside traditional endurance work can improve both performance and postural health.
🔄 Tracking Your Progress Beyond the Mirror
How do you know if your rib flare correction work is actually working? Beyond visual assessment, here are functional markers to track:
- Improved breathing mechanics: You should notice belly breathing becoming more natural and chest breathing decreasing.
- Reduced lower back discomfort: Many people experience immediate reduction in lower back tension as rib position improves.
- Better lift performance: With proper core stability, most people see improvements in pressing strength and squat/deadlift numbers.
- Decreased neck and shoulder tension: As you stop compensatory breathing, chronically tight upper traps and neck muscles often relax.
- Enhanced endurance: Efficient breathing mechanics improve oxygen delivery and reduce wasted energy.
🌟 Making It Stick: Integration Into Daily Life
Fixing rib flare isn’t just about what you do in the gym—your postural habits throughout the day matter enormously. If you spend eight hours sitting with poor posture, flared ribs, and shallow breathing, your one-hour training session can’t fully counteract that.
Set hourly reminders on your phone to check in with your posture. Are your ribs stacked over your pelvis? Are you breathing into your belly or your chest? These micro-corrections throughout the day reinforce the patterns you’re building during training.
Consider your sleeping position as well. Sleeping on your stomach often encourages rib flare and spinal extension. Side sleeping with proper pillow support or back sleeping with a pillow under your knees can help maintain better alignment even during rest.
Your car seat setup, standing desk height, and even how you hold your phone all contribute to your habitual postures. Making these environments more posture-friendly supports your corrective work rather than fighting against it.

💡 The Mind-Muscle Connection for Core Control
Ultimately, mastering rib position is about developing exceptional body awareness and control. This isn’t something that happens overnight—it’s a skill that improves with consistent, mindful practice.
Start each training session with a brief body scan. Notice where you’re holding tension, how you’re breathing, and where your ribs are positioned. This self-awareness allows you to make corrections before they become movement compensations under load.
Film yourself regularly performing key exercises from the side angle. What looks and feels like good position to you might look quite different on video. This visual feedback is invaluable for calibrating your internal sense of alignment with actual positioning.
Remember that perfection isn’t the goal—improvement is. Some degree of positional variation is normal and healthy. You’re not trying to maintain rigid, military posture at all times. Instead, you’re expanding your movement options and eliminating compensatory patterns that limit performance and increase injury risk.
